The Current State of EV Infrastructure
Canada has made remarkable progress in expanding its EV charging network. As of 2024, there are over 16,000 public charging stations across the country, with a mix of Level 2 and DC fast chargers. This growth represents a 35% increase from the previous year, showcasing the rapid development in this sector.
Government Initiatives Driving Growth
The Canadian government has implemented several initiatives to boost EV infrastructure:
- Zero-Emission Vehicle Infrastructure Program (ZEVIP): Investing $280 million to support the installation of EV chargers.
- Electric Vehicle and Alternative Fuel Infrastructure Deployment Initiative: Providing funding for a coast-to-coast network of fast-charging stations.
- Provincial incentives: Many provinces offer additional support for EV charging infrastructure development.

Impact on Sustainable Transportation
The expansion of EV charging networks is having a profound impact on sustainable transportation in Canada:
- Increased EV Adoption: As range anxiety decreases, more Canadians are switching to electric vehicles.
- Reduced Emissions: The shift to EVs is significantly lowering greenhouse gas emissions from the transportation sector.
- Energy Efficiency: EVs are more energy-efficient than traditional combustion engine vehicles, contributing to overall energy savings.
- Grid Integration: Smart charging technologies are being developed to balance electricity demand and support grid stability.
Challenges and Future Prospects
While progress is evident, challenges remain:
- Rural Coverage: Expanding infrastructure to less populated areas is crucial for nationwide adoption.
- Charging Speed: Continued development of ultra-fast charging technology is needed to rival refueling times of conventional vehicles.
- Grid Capacity: Upgrading the electrical grid to handle increased demand from EVs is an ongoing process.
